Direct View LED Video Wall Solutions
Direct view LED video wall technology is becoming a leader in the large-scale digital signage market due to its ability to deliver seamless images, scalability to any size or shape, and superb optimal characteristics that make video wall content look excellent from ANY angle.
LightWerks specializes in the design and integration of direct view LED video wall solutions that enable organizations to deliver content that engages, informs, and entertains.

Zoomtopia 2019
This month, LightWerks attended Zoom's annual user conference, Zoomtopia, in San Jose, California. The event included workshops, hands-on demonstrations, networking opportunities, and announcements about exciting product updates and partnerships. World-renowned keynote speakers at the conference included actor and producer, Zachary Quinto, former NASA astronaut, Mike Massimino, and Virgin Group founder, Sir Richard Branson.
LightWerks and University of California Sign Purchasing Agreement
On August 28, 2019 LightWerks Communication Systems was awarded a competitively bid, 5 year contract with the University of California. The contractallows University of California (UC), California State Universities (CSU) and Community College campuses (CCC) to procure audio visual goods and services at competitive rates.
